(Giving 100 pts, help fast!!!) Four congruent square pieces with lengths of sides of 6 cm were cut out of corners of a square pi

ece of cardboard. Then this piece of cardboard was folded into an open-top box. Find the original dimensions of the piece of cardboard if the volume of the resulting box is 486 cm3.

Answer:

21x21 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Volume =whl

Given: V=486, and h=6, and w=l

So we can it into this equation: 486=6(l^2)

to solve we isolate the variable by dividing each side by factors that don't contain the variable.

which therefore l = 9

Then we add 6(height) +9(l)+6(width)

6+9+6=21 therefore the sides of cardboard are 21 cm × 21 cm

The terms in the sequence decrease by the same amount each time:
luda_lava [24]

Answer:the nth term of the sequence, Tn= -3n +12

Step-by-step explanation:

The nth term of an arithmetic progression is given as

Tn=  a+ (n-1) d

where a= first term

and d = common difference

In this sequence, 9, 6 ,3 ,0, -3, -6 we can see that  the number is decreasing by 3

The first term, a= 9

and common difference, d = -3

using our formulae

Tn=  a+ (n-1) d

Tn= 9 + ( n-1) -3

Tn=9- 3n+ 3

Tn= -3n +12
